This new burger joint branch in Pasay lets customers build their own burger!

Picky eaters, rejoice!

Burger Beast, the popular burger joint created by award-winning chef Carlo Miguel, just opened a new branch in Pasay City with an exclusive offer: a build your own burger (BYOB) kiosk!

Whether you prefer having peanut butter on your burger or you enjoy having the rich and tangy touch of kimchi, Burger Beast’s wide array of choices will surely delight you.

The touch-screen kiosks are right in front of the store, allowing customers to customize their burger to their liking. Building your own burger begins with choosing a patty. There are four to choose from: regular beef, smashed, steamed, and crispy chicken.

Then you choose your cheese: American, cheese sauce, mozzarella, Swiss, and bleu.

Then comes the exciting part: Choosing from over 10 sauces. There's the beast ketchup, garlic aioli, BBQ, dijon mustard, buffalo, peanut butter, caesar, yellow mustard, truffle, cilantro aioli, teriyaki, and the secret umami sauce, which Chef Carlo concocted himself!

And the finally, the fixings. Customers will have to choose three the following options: lettuce, tomatoes, pineapple, jalapenos, bacon, mushrooms, pickles, fried egg, kimchi, grilled onions, fresh onions, caramelized onions, and balsamic onions.

Upon finalizing the order, it's to the counter to pay. BYOB burgers start at P375. 

Don't feel like customizing your burgers? Burger Beast’s signature burgers — like the popular Umami Burger, Truffle Burger, or Super Cali Smashed Burger — are also available.

By the way, the MOA branch of Burger Beast also has an exclusive beer on the menu. It's called the Beast Brew, and its a fruity character perfectly complements Burger Beast’s menu items.

3/F, South Entertainment Mall in SM Mall of Asia.
